Note
1:
Limits are 100% production tested at T
A = +25°C. Limits over the operating temperature range are ensured through cor-
relation using Statistical Quality Control (SQC) methods.
2:
Validated by line regulation test.
3:
Not tested. For design purposes, the current limit should be considered 150 mA minimum to 410 mA maximum.
4:
The dropout voltage is defined as (V
IN – VOUT) when VOUT is 100 mV below the value of VOUT for
V
IN = VOUT +2V.
